Get your Ice Skates ready, because the ice skating rink in Bentonville opens this Saturday, Nov. 20

  • Place: It’s called The Rink and it’s at Lawrence Plaza 214 NE A St. The Rink is 7,000 sq/ft of ice over a concrete pad in downtown and stays chilled and solid through the first two weeks of February 2022. 
  • Price: Tickets to ice skate are $7 per person per session. Or you can get a Family Season Pass Ice Rink Membership for $75, and it is good for 6 family members per day. There is opportunity to host private parties on the rink as well as take lessons

The annual Lights of the Ozarks is this coming weekend! We don’t know about you, but we’re pumped. 

  • Hard work: The City of Fayetteville Parks and Recreation Department will have spent over 2000 hours decorating the downtown square with over 500,000 lights just in time for the lighting ceremony Nov. 19 at 6p. 
  • Tis the season: Right after the switch is flipped on Friday, the Lighting Night Parade will commence on their new route to kick off the season. Each year the Lights of the Ozarks embody the holiday spirit, shining from 5p-1a each evening until Jan. 1, 2022. Don’t miss the festivities complete with treats, hot cocoa, and music!

Northwest Arkansas is about to be home to another major expansion

  • Moving in: Electric vehicle company, Canoo, has decided to place its corporate headquarters and advanced industrialization facility in Bentonville. It also has plans for a research and development center in Fayetteville. 
  • One step at a time: Canoo was established in 2017 and is currently thriving in multiple states. The company has designed vehicles that are purpose-built and customizable to any consumer. Canoo’s vision is that one day everyone would have an electric vehicle. Who knows? NWA might be the place that makes it possible.

After months of renovations and preparations, the breakfast place we all know and love has officially landed in Fayetteville! The Buttered Biscuit is softly open at its new location. 

  • Take it to-go: The new location is at 1754 North College Avenue in Fayetteville and is currently only open for drive-thru, while final touches are being made to the building. Fayetteville’s is the first location to have a drive-thru, so go check it out!
  • Good, classic breakfast: The Buttered Biscuit was brought to life by a stay-at-home mom, who loves a good breakfast and calls Arkansas home. She and her husband have developed and led teams now at 4 Buttered Biscuit locations in NWA.
